Eleuthera is most famous for its 100 miles of spectacular, deserted beaches. It has a population of just 8000, and everyone knows everyone. It’s famous for being very safe. The snorkeling and diving on the island are world class. There are many reefs which you can snorkel or dive right from the beach. The fishing is also excellent, because the island is so undeveloped and thinly populated. Bonefishing is very big, as is deep sea fishing and reef fishing. You can fish on your own or hire a guide. Boating, surfing, and other water sports are also popular. You can rent power boats, sailboats, sea kayaks, paddle boards, jet skis, bikes, and scooters. You can have a charter captain take you out for fishing, snorkeling, or diving excursions. There are several popular spots for cliff jumping, including some tame enough for children. There is excellent sightseeing as well. Eleuthera has vast caves, cliffs, a bottomless ocean hole, dozens of beaches, each one unique, some historic churches and 19th century homes, and little villages to explore. There are local tour guides who can show you around. The island is truly magical.

Beautiful peaceful location. Pool is a huge bonus.
Clean well appointed house. Doesn't really have an ocean view due to the sea grapes across the street, but the little beach across the street is a two minute walk and is perfect for swimming and snorkeling with small kids (when the seas are flat), or body surfing and wave jumping for the adults when it's wavy. Hidden beach is a 10 minute walk, and for the adventurous, the Cliffs is about a 1/2 hour walk or a 5 minute drive and are spectacular. Wear appropriate footwear as the limestone cliffs are extremely jagged to walk on. Walk down the sunken road 300 yards to the west of the house to find a spectacular little cove open to the ocean perfect for wading and enjoying a cold one. The pool was clean and the perfect compliment to the beach across the street. Excellent for rinsing off he salt after swimming in the ocean. We got into Governors Harbor airport before 10am and Nicky was kind enough to meet us at the house early so we could start our trip to paradise as soon as possible. This is our third trip to Eleuthera, so we knew what to expect. Yes, the power goes out occasionally, and yes there are no seeums in the evenings but that is a small price to pay. We explored 25 beaches in 6 days and each one has it's own unique flavor and charm. Only 3 had other people on them. The house is easy to get to from Queens Highway and secluded enough that we only saw 3 cars drive down the road the whole time we were there. We will be back.

We had a wonderful time in Eleuthera. Beautiful Island, very underdeveloped, no crowds. The Queen's highway is main route and will take you everywhere, use goggle maps & you will need a rental car. Do not drive after dark, road is dangerous, no lights. Come and Go Villa Property was clean, great kitchen, washer dryer, AC, bedrooms clean, comfortable, bathrooms clean, updated, lots of bath towels, beach towels, close to Rainbow bay- a must see on the Caribbean side. The pool was very nice, and the view was breathtaking of the Atlantic. rocky beach just across road. Good internet and cable. Very comfortable for 2 couples. I would go back. Now, just a few things need to be attended to and the management company was open to the suggestions: the closet doors in both bedrooms are either broken off track or stuck, faucet in one bathroom loose, outside grill very old and only one side fired up, hard to use to cook your fish, one of the chaise loungers out by pool with ripped cover so unable to lay down and use, 3 out of the 4 chairs at the umbrella table with arms broken off and fungus growing on them, those need to be replaced. It is the islands, so be prepared for a slower lifestyle. It was really relaxing. Bring plenty or bug spray! for nighttime and use long sleeves and pants at night. I got nailed with the no-see-ums (little black knats) small bites that itch like crazy. Overall, it was great, the food in restaurants fresh and tasty and the people friendly and helpful.
